阿里云区块链平台全面解析:功能、优势及应用

              时间:2026-01-25 19:19:23

              主页 > 热门探索 >

              
                  

              随着区块链技术的快速发展,越来越多的企业认识到其在各行各业中的应用潜力。阿里云作为一家领先的云计算服务提供商,推出了多款区块链服务,致力于为企业提供可靠的区块链基础设施和开发工具。在这篇文章中,我们将详细探讨阿里云的区块链平台,包括其主要功能、优势、应用场景以及与之相关的重要问题。

              阿里云区块链平台概述

              阿里云的区块链平台是一个基于云计算的区块链服务,提供可高度定制化的区块链解决方案。该平台支持多种区块链协议,并允许用户在公有云或私有云环境中构建和部署区块链网络。用户可以选择自己熟悉的技术栈和工具,从而更快地实现区块链应用的落地。

              主要功能

              阿里云区块链平台提供了一系列功能,旨在简化区块链应用的开发和部署。这些功能包括:智能合约管理、身份管理、资产管理、数据共享等。

              使用阿里云区块链平台的优势

              选择阿里云的区块链服务,企业可以享受到多个方面的优势。

              阿里云区块链的应用场景

              阿里云的区块链服务可以广泛应用于多个领域,以下是一些典型的应用场景:

              可能相关的问题

              1. 阿里云的区块链平台是否支持私有链和公有链?

              阿里云不仅支持公有链的搭建,也可以依据企业需求搭建私有链。这一灵活性使得企业能够在公有链的开源环境中享受高透明度与安全,但在特定的场合下又能选择私有链来保护敏感数据。在很多情况下,企业会选择混合链的构架,以便更好地实现业务的灵活性。

              私有链一般适合需要保护数据隐私和进行权限管理的场景,比如金融、医疗等行业,而公有链则更适合于需要广泛访问和参与的场景,例如某些共享经济业务。在阿里云的区块链平台上,用户可以基于自身需求来选择不同的链类型。其提供的向导工具和文档也能帮助用户快速上手,降低学习成本。

              2. 如何在阿里云区块链平台上开发智能合约?

              在阿里云区块链平台上开发智能合约的流程相对简单。首先,用户需要在阿里云控制台上创建一个区块链网络,选择合适的链类型,然后根据平台提供的API与SDK进行智能合约的编写与部署。

              智能合约通常采用特定的编程语言,例如Solidity(对于以太坊)。开发者可以根据业务需求撰写合约,测试合约并确保其在区块链上的性能和安全。阿里云为开发者提供了环境配置、调试工具及代码示例,帮助用户更高效地进行智能合约的开发。

              一旦智能合约完成,用户可以通过平台进行审核和部署,将其上线。部署后,智能合约会在区块链网络中执行,所有操作都能被追溯,确保业务逻辑的透明性和不可篡改性。

              3. 阿里云如何确保区块链平台的安全性?

              阿里云在区块链平台的安全建设上采取了全面的安全措施。首先,在数据传输过程中,采用了TLS加密协议,确保数据在客户端和服务器之间传输时的安全。此外,阿里云还提供了多重身份验证及权限管理,确保只有授权用户才能访问敏感数据。

              其次,平台在区块链系统的网络架构上采取了分布式的结构,避免单点故障。同时,引入了防DDoS攻击的策略,强化了基础设施的安全性。对智能合约的代码,阿里云也会提供一定的代码审核功能,防止部署出现安全漏洞。

              此外,阿里云定期进行安全审计,并与专门的安全团队合作,不断更新和安全策略,以应对日益变化的网络安全威胁。

              4. 阿里云区块链平台的性能如何?

              阿里云区块链平台的性能表现通常受到多方面因素的影响,如区块链的类型、网络的配置、底层协议等。一般而言,阿里云在其云服务的基础设施上进行了,提供高性能的计算与存储支持。

              以交易处理速度为例,阿里云的区块链平台能够处理上千笔交易,不同类型的区块链可能会有不同的性能表现。例如,公有链在大规模众多用户参与下会有性能上升,但在通过合并交易、数据封存等机制下,私有链在特定场景中也能达到可观的交易效率。

              而对于延迟问题,阿里云通过在全球不同的地理位置部署数据中心,确保用户在使用区块链服务时可以获得较低的延迟。同时,其的网络架构设计能够有效提高数据传输的效率。这为企业在实用区块链应用时提供了更好的用户体验。

              5. 如何在阿里云平台上实现区块链与现有系统的集成?

              在阿里云区块链平台上集成现有系统通常是一个循序渐进的过程,根据不同企业的业务需求,具体步骤可能会有所不同。首先,企业需要明确想要集成的具体场景与目标,如数据共享、用户身份验证等。

              其次,利用阿里云提供的API和SDK,企业可以在其现有系统中调用区块链网络的功能。例如,可以通过API将用户的数据写入到区块链,或从区块链读取相关信息。阿里云平台支持多种编程语言,这为开发者提供了灵活性。

              最后,需要考虑的是后期运维问题。企业应建立必要的监控机制,以便实时跟踪区块链应用的运行状况,及时发现并解决潜在问题。阿里云提供了丰富的监控和报警工具,能帮助企业实时了解区块链服务的健康状态。

              综上所述,阿里云的区块链平台为企业提供了一种灵活、安全、高效的区块链解决方案。通过利用这一平台,企业能够更好地实现业务创新和转型,推动区块链技术的实际应用,实现可持续发展。